WebMar 31, 2024 · cringe ( countable and uncountable, plural cringes ) ( countable) A gesture or posture of cringing ( recoiling or shrinking ). He glanced with a cringe at the mess on his desk. ( countable, figuratively) An act or disposition of servile obeisance. Webcringed, cringes, cringing To draw back, bend, crouch, etc., as when afraid; shrink from something dangerous or painful. Webster's New World Similar definitions To act in a timid, servile manner; fawn. Webster's New World Similar definitions (dated, intransitive) To bow or crouch in servility. Wiktionary Synonyms: cower creep grovel crawl fawn funk
